The Parkview Lady Vikings beat West Plains 3-0 on Tuesday night, making them an undefeated 9-0 in the Ozark Conference, and 15-3 overall. This is the first time that Parkview had ever won the Ozark Conference on the girls’ side.
The Scoring was started by Melanie Allen, and the Vikings also got goals from Jessica Maerz and Amanda Leckrone. West Plains defended well and made Parkview work, but the Vikings did not give up many scoring chances on their way to victory. Parkview was able to send the ball to the wings consistently against the Zizzers, with the majority of the attack coming from crosses, including Loderhose’s cross to Leckrone for the third goal of the night.

Scoring Summary: Melanie Allen 1g, Jessica Maerz 1g, Amanda Leckrone 1g, Kelsey Loderhose 2a
The PHS JV had a 2-1 come from behind victory. Marie Maize scored 2 goals, and Mary Langebartel had 1 assist. After the Vikings gave up an early goal, Maize was able to get one back when she surprised the keeper with an early shot through traffic. The score was 1-1 at half, until Maize stole the ball from a Zizzer defender and took it to goal for the Vikings’ second goal, and a 2-1 victory.
